Comments:
Healthy specimen with balanced and even crown. Lots of sapsucker feeding on the trunk, but doesn't appear to be affecting vitality of tree. Species identification is uncertain. It doesn't match traits well with any of the well known native and nonnative fir species. A defining characteristic of this tree is that the cone bracts are exserted. This narrows the possibilities considerably. Leading possibilities for the species identification based on cone, bark, form, and needles include: Abies alba, Abies cephalonica, Abies firma, Abies procera, Abies koreana.
